An entrepreneur who remained kidnapped for 19 days in the Lara state, a central-western region of Venezuela, was released on Sunday, May 18 after a relative made a payment in cryptoactive of 800,000 dollars of the million that the kidnappers initially demanded, according to police reports accessed by the press. The band, as reported by Lara's press, It was made by «the active crypto» for their preference for digital currencies. Payment was made in USDT, the main market stable that maintains the same price as the dollar (USD), which is issued by the Tether company, as explained by the cryptopedic cryptopedia. The case has generated commotion in the country when the alleged participation of active and inactive officials of the National Anti -Extortion and Kidnapping (Conas) officials of the Bolivarian National Guard, together with civilians. According to the police report, seen by the Venezuelan environment NTN24 after the complaint filed by the victim, the kidnapping was perpetrated by a group of at least ten people, among which which Eight officials and former conunctions of Conas would be countedin addition to two civilians. The victim moved in her vehicle on April 30 when she was intercepted by three individuals dressed in black who carried long weapons, who forced him to board another car. After a tour of approximately 30 minutes, he was locked in an abandoned house, the report points out. After the complaint, the authorities initiated the investigations that led to the arrest of five people allegedly linked to the fact. Among those captured is Garrido Sánchez Roger Sánchez (48 years old), identified as Sergeant Supervisor of Conas in the Portuguese state, who is accused of planning, perpetrating and negotiating the kidnapping. Kender Alexander Castillo Osta (42), former member of Conas; Natanael David Saavedra Alvarado (39), former member of Conas; Robert Jesús Garrido Sánchez (47), civil and alleged owner of the place of captivity, who would also have exercised caretaker functions; and Ángel Rafael Martínez Rodríguez, aka «El Negro» (44), civil, also indicated as a caregiver.

The authorities reported that five other individuals, allegedly involved in kidnapping, were identified, but They are currently running. Among them are mentioned Lieutenant Colonel Arturo Gómez Morantes (ex-cheeks); the sergeant of II Julio Rivero (active GNB); The Sergeant Mayor II Neomar Páez (Conas); a sergeant greater than III surnamed Páez (Conas); and Sergeant First Marco Márquez (ex-gosses). During the detention operation, logistics material was seized, including 11 cell phones, balaclavas, tactical helmets, wives, a satellite internet antenna, a Chevrolet brand vehicle Optra model, an HK brand rifle, three guns (Beretta, Browning and Tanfoglio brands), three AR-15 loaders and a smoke grenade. However, nothing was specified about cryptocurrency funds that the victim's relatives paid to the kidnappers.
